Turning off the power automatically after a certain period of time
Windows 7
Set time for [The optical disc drive's power] on [Extension setting - Edit] screen of Power Plan Extension Utility beforehand.
After turning on the CD/DVD drive or removing the disc by opening the disc cover, when a certain period time passes with the
cover closed without setting a disc, you can automatically turn the drive off. (
Windows XP
[Auto Off Setting] of this utility automatically turns the drive power off after the CD/DVD drive power has been turned on, or
after a disc has been removed from the CD/DVD drive, if a certain period of time passes during which a disc is not set in the
drive.

NOTE
In the following cases, the drive power will not turn off even after the time set in [Auto Off Setting].
• When a disc is set in the drive
• When an external CD/DVD drive is connected
• When WinDVD is running
